About Washington Elementary School

Washington Elementary School is a regular public elementary school located in the heart of Medford, Oregon. The school serves students from kindergarten through fifth grade with an enrollment of 263 students and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 14.6:1. With 18 full-time equivalent teachers on staff, Washington Elementary provides a supportive learning environment where each child receives individual attention.

Academically, the school is currently focusing on student development, as indicated by its MySchoolScout rating of 3.3 out of 10 and state ranking of #1045 out of 1231 schools in Oregon (placing it at the 15th percentile). The average proficiency rates for ELA/Reading are 26%, while Math proficiency stands at 18%. Despite these challenges, Washington Elementary is committed to improving educational outcomes and supporting each student's growth.

Washington Elementary School is situated in a small city setting within Jackson County. The school community is integral to the neighborhood, fostering close ties with local families and organizations.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Washington Elementary School has a median household income of $61,971. It is a community where 20%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$325,200, with a median rent of $1,238/month. The area has a poverty rate of 14.2%. Residents enjoy a short average commute of 18 minutes.
